About This Book

Have you ever wondered what happens when a roly-poly spider eats too much? This spider munches on a beetle, a caterpillar, and even a bumblebee, growing round and round. But what will happen when it gets stuck in a waterspout?

Quick Assessment

This charming early reader follows a plump spider who overeats a variety of insects and finds itself temporarily stuck in a waterspout. Suitable for ages 5-8, the story offers gentle humor and simple vocabulary to engage young readers while introducing themes about nature and consequences. There is no intense content, making it appropriate for early elementary children.
